Missouri became a part of the United States in 1803 with the Louisiana Purchase. In 1805 it was part of the Louisiana Territory and in 1812 became a separate Territory, and in 1821 Missouri became the 24th State.
The first Federal Census taken for the State was the 1830 Census. In the 1830 and 1840 census both males and females are listed 0-4, 5-9, 10-14, 15- 19, 20-29, 30-39, 40-49, 50-59, etc.
From 1850 on ages and states of birth are shown. In 1880 places of birth are listed for the person, their father and their mother. In the 1880 Soundex only families with children under 10 are listed. In the 1900 and later Soundex, all families are listed.
